Job Description

The Interventional Cardiology APP provides advanced clinical care to adult cardiovascular patients in both inpatient and outpatient settings under the supervision of collaborating interventional cardiologists. This role includes patient evaluation, peri-procedural management, diagnostic interpretation, treatment planning, patient education, and coordination of care across the continuum of cardiovascular services. The PA functions as an integral member of the cardiovascular team, supporting high-quality, evidence-based care for patients with acute and chronic cardiovascular conditions. Responsibilities Perform comprehensive history and physical examinations Round daily with attending interventional cardiologists and multidisciplinary care teams Monitor and manage post-procedural patients, including hemodynamic monitoring, vascular access site assessments, and complication surveillance Order, review, and interpret diagnostic testing including ECGs, telemetry, laboratory data, echocardiograms, and stress testing Develop and implement treatment plans in collaboration with supervising physicians Coordinate discharge planning, medication reconciliation, follow-up care, and patient education Respond to inpatient cardiovascular consultations and urgent patient needs Participate in call coverage, weekend rotations, and hospital-based cardiovascular emergencies as assigned Qualifications Education Graduate of an accredited Physician Assistant or Nurse Practitioner program Master's degree required Licensure and Certification Current Physician Assistant/Nurse Practitioner license in West Virginia Nationally accredited certification as Physician Assistant/Nurse Practitioner
